- Werner resigns as mayor. Poppy tries to confess Werner her affair with Michael. A fine threat lets Michael and Nathalie restart as a music duo. Luisa doesn't want Sebastian to see her. She is Hermann's daughter. Beatrice plays a game.
- Upset Poppy leaves Michael; she doesn't love him and she is married to Werner. André who just enters the house doesn't believe Michael who says he just showed her some acupuncture points. He asks André to forget it. Julia is with Tina. Poppy knocks on the door and asks Tina if she can sleep with her. They want to know what happened and Poppy confesses she slept with Michael. Poppy decides the next day to confess it also Werner. Charlotte knows about Werner's resignation as mayor. She advices him to resign as his own initiative. He takes her advice and arranges a press meeting. Hildegard worries; Alfons thinks she did the right thing. André and Michael get a quarrel about what happened but finally make it up. Poppy makes Michael clear that she wants to tell Werner what happened. She finds Werner in the apartment but Werner has no time because he has the press meeting now. He tells the press he resigns because he is too busy. He asks Hildegard to become interim-mayor; she accepts it as next in line. Charlotte thinks Werner should repair his marriage. Julia advices Poppy to tell Werner about her affair now because there is never a good moment to tell it. Poppy runs to him and he offers her his excuses. Lorenz calls music producer André. André informs him that the music duo Nathalie and Michael ended. Lorenz reacts with a contractual fine. André assembles a meeting with Nathalie and Michael and he shows them the high fine. Will the duo restart? Nathalie visits Michael later and he convinces her to go on. Stefan informs Patrizia that the divorce from Niklas is official. She decides to call herself Patrizia Dietrich. She wants to know more of Stefan personally. Luisa finds Sebastian's message on the pier. She hesitates, looks at her hump and doesn't call him at first. Finally she calls Sebastian and asks him to send the bow to her. He tries to meet her to give it her in person but she insists on sending it. Luisa visits Julia in her store to fetch her mended violin bag. Julia discovers Luisa is the young woman Sebastian did see near the lake. She discusses it with Niklas. Beatrice has a phone call with her son David. Hermann invites her to the piano bar but she tells him she is tired and wants to go to bed. She says to her son she has turned the jurist around her finger. Beatrice lets Hermann know about the name "Marta" in his ornament. He confesses her he had a relation with Marta many years ago. They go into her room and kiss each other while falling on the bed. Later: Hermann and Beatrice walk in the forest. Luisa shows up and turns out to be his daughter.—B. Dijkhoff
